As I have mentioned I am designing a 6AU6 based mic preamp. Thanks to
Patrick et al I now have hum free HT rails. However, I still find some
50Hz hum and 10mS period PSU spikes in the output. By shorting the grid
of the first stage these both disappear so that is where they are
getting in. By turning off the HT they also both disappear so it seems

Not all is gloom in the dynamic range midden. I've just been pulling
to pieces a bit of Led Zeppelin to compare a recent CD of LZ IV with
my original vinyl copy. I'm happy to be able to report that the new CD
has hugely *increased* dynamics over the vinyl, and there is no sign
of any mastering engineer making it loud.

I often see volume control pots with their wiper connected directly to
the grid of the following tube. Trouble is as they wear they get a bit
scratchy and often lead to the grid becoming disconnected. Would you
agree it is good practice to add a resistor (say 1Meg) directly across
the grid?
